Italy's premier-designate Giuseppe Conte leaves his house in Rome, Friday, June 1, 2018. Italy's president has tapped politically inexperienced law professor Giuseppe Conte to be the premier who will head Italy's first populist government. The president's office announced Thursday that Conte had accepted the role and would be sworn in Friday afternoon with Cabinet ministers. (Massimo Percossi/ANSA via AP)
